Calculate the molar conductivity of 0.2 M KCl solution at 298 K ( k = 0.0248 ⁻¹ cm ⁻¹ )
Options
- A143 ⁻¹ cm ^2 mol ⁻¹
- B98 ⁻¹ cm ^2 mol ⁻¹
- C124 ⁻¹ cm ^2 mol ⁻¹
- D87 ⁻¹ cm ^2 mol ⁻¹
Correct answer
C. 124 ⁻¹ cm ^2 mol ⁻¹
Step-by-step solution
Given concentration C = 0.2 M and conductivity k = 0.0248 ⁻¹ cm ⁻¹ . The formula for molar conductivity is _m = k 1000 C . Substituting the given values: _m = 0.0248 1000 0.2 _m = 24.8 0.2 = 124 ⁻¹ cm ^2 mol ⁻¹ . Answer: 124 ⁻¹ cm ^2 mol ⁻¹
